Anki/rslib
Damien Elmes 308c663233 Reset filtered decks at import time
Before this change, filtered decks exported with scheduling remained
filtered on import, and maybe_remove_from_filtered_deck() moved cards
into them as their home deck, leading to errors during review.

We may still want to provide a way to preserve filtered decks on import,
but to do that we'll need to ensure we don't rewrite the home decks of
cards, and we'll need to ensure the home decks are included as part of
the import (or give an error if they're not).

https://github.com/ankitects/anki/pull/1743/files#r839346423
2022-04-27 14:48:47 +10:00
..
.cargo initial Bazel conversion 2020-11-01 14:26:58 +10:00
benches New TTS/AV tag handling (#1559) 2021-12-17 19:04:42 +10:00
build Backup improvements (#1728) 2022-03-21 19:40:42 +10:00
cargo Update Rust deps 2022-03-15 16:51:52 +10:00
i18n Fix some clippy lints + imports 2022-03-17 21:03:39 +10:00
i18n_helpers Update Rust deps 2022-03-15 16:51:52 +10:00
linkchecker Update Rust deps 2022-03-15 16:51:52 +10:00
src Reset filtered decks at import time 2022-04-27 14:48:47 +10:00
tests/support move linkchecker into separate crate 2021-12-20 17:27:43 +10:00
.gitignore initial Bazel conversion 2020-11-01 14:26:58 +10:00
bench.sh New TTS/AV tag handling (#1559) 2021-12-17 19:04:42 +10:00
BUILD.bazel Backups (#1685) 2022-03-07 15:11:31 +10:00
Cargo.toml Colpkg fixes (#1722) 2022-03-17 15:11:23 +10:00
empty.rs Backend Custom Study (#1600) 2022-01-20 14:25:22 +10:00
README.md add some code editing/completion docs 2020-12-16 14:16:08 +10:00
rustfmt.bzl Update to latest rules_rust, which unblocks the tokio upgrade 2022-03-03 19:48:17 +10:00
rustfmt.toml tidy up Rust imports 2021-04-18 18:38:54 +10:00

Anki's Rust code.

backend.proto stores the interfaces used to communicate backend messages between Rust, Python and TypeScript.